Restrictions

Skydivers are NOT a race of Superhuman Daredevils.... They are ordinary men and women of all shapes and sizes that range in age from late teens to late sixties.  The one thing they all share in common is the love of the sport and the appreciation of the excitement it puts into their lives.

You will be pleased to learn that there are very few restrictions to becoming a skydiver.  All parachute courses run by Ph.D Skydiving will be run in accordance with BPA rules regardless of the location of the host DZ. So with this in mind here are the restrictions imposed on our courses:

  • You must be between 16 and 50 years of age. (although there can be exceptions to the upper limit) If you are under 18 you must have written consent off your parent or guardian.
  • You should be of reasonable health, please read the BPA medical declaration (included in our information pack) before signing it.  If you are over 40 you must obtain a doctor's signature on the BPA declaration of fitness form.
  • You should be of reasonable fitness but suppleness is more important than strength, advice on recommended pre course stretching exercises will be included in our information pack.
  • Your weight roughly in proportion to your height and no more than 15 stone / 95 kg.
  • The wearing of glasses or contact lenses is not a problem.
A sense of fun and an enthusiastic nature are highly recommended !
